Workflow: Create a Task When Card Enters a Specific Status in Ontraccr

āœ… Workflow: Create a Task When Card Enters a Specific Status in Ontraccr
 

Overview

This automation creates a task on a card whenever it moves into a specific status (column). It’s used to enforce structured follow-ups, trigger required actions, or assign work automatically based on progress in your workflow.


šŸŽÆ When to Use This Workflow

Use this when:

  • You want to automatically trigger to-do items at specific workflow stages
  • You want to assign work based on card movement (e.g., ā€œApply for Permitā€)
  • You need structured checklists in place as cards progress
  • You want tasks to follow consistent due dates, assignments, or reminders

🧩 How to Set It Up

  1. Open the board where this should apply.
  2. Go to Settings > Workflows.
  3. Click the āž• Add button.
  4. Set up the automation as follows:

šŸ”§ Setup Fields

FieldDescription
NameLabel it (e.g., ā€œCreate task when card hits ā€˜Ready for Reviewā€™ā€)
TypeSelect: Create a task when card enters a specific status
StatusChoose the status that will trigger the task
Task SetupCreate the task inline or select from a task template

šŸ“ Task Details to Configure

When creating the task manually, define:

FieldPurpose
Task TitleRequired — what should the task be called (e.g., ā€œSubmit for Permitā€)
DescriptionOptional — any task notes or context
Assigned UserChoose a specific user, or use Auto-assign from Card User (recommended)
Due Date LogicSet due date as X days after card enters the status, or based on a date field (e.g., ā€œBid Due Dateā€)
RemindersConfigure who gets reminders and when (e.g., 2 days before due)
PrioritySet urgency (Lowest → Highest)
StatusTypically starts as ā€œTo Doā€
Attach Form (Optional)Attach a specific form to be filled out with this task

āœ… Example Use Case

  • When a project card moves to ā€œPermit Requiredā€, a task called ā€œSubmit City Permit Applicationā€ is automatically created
  • It is:
    • Assigned to the project coordinator from the card
    • Due 3 business days later
    • Includes a linked form to submit directly
    • Sends reminders to coordinator and PM

This ensures no manual follow-up is needed — the process kicks off immediately.


🧠 Tips & Edge Cases

  • The Auto-assign from Card User option is great for flexible routing
  • You can create recurring tasks, though it’s mostly used for inspections
  • If your board has a Form Requirement, attach it to the task so it’s accessible from My Tasks or the card
  • Task appears in both the card’s Task tab and in the user’s My Tasks dashboard
